Server Description
A balanced virtual server with fast local NVMe storage, strong single-core performance, and a shared CPU architecture for general-purpose workloads.
Vultr vhf-4c-16gb is a virtual server in the High Frequency Compute family, configured with 4 shared Intel x86_64 vCPUs, 16.0 GB of RAM, and a bundled 384 GB NVMe SSD. Operating at 2.0 GHz, its dual-core, multi-threaded processor delivers strong single-core CPU performance in stress-ng benchmarks, though multi-core performance and PassMark CPU scores remain average. Memory performance shows a distinct tradeoff, with average cached read bandwidth but weak uncached large-block read and write speeds. Application benchmarks indicate average throughput for Redis SET operations and small LLM text generation, but weak results for database operations and static web serving. Given its shared CPU architecture and balanced 1:4 memory-to-vCPU ratio, this server is qualitatively cost-effective for general-purpose workloads, development environments, and lightweight caching applications that utilize local NVMe storage without requiring dedicated, continuous multi-core compute power.
